Shop Dpf Diesel Particulate Filter Cleaner in Trinidad and Tobago|Automotive|Shop Globally|Desertcart
Dpf Diesel Particulate Filter Cleaner Available Now In Trinidad And Tobago|automotive
DPF Diesel Particulate Filter Cleaner for automotive maintenance. Shop now for fast delivery in Trinidad and Tobago. Wide selection of automotive products available.